Licensed Practical Nurse LPN Night Shift

Troup County Jail | Georgia ⏰ Full-Time Nights | 7:00 PM to 7:30 AM Rotating Schedule Including Every Other Weekend

When the rest of the world clocks out, this team clocks in

Southern Health Partners is seeking a dedicated Full-Time LPN for our night shift team at the Troup County Jail in Georgia. This is a role for nurses who stay steady under pressure, think critically, and want their work to matter every single shift.

Correctional nursing brings together medical, emergency, and behavioral health experience in a setting where your skills stay active and your nights move with purpose. No endless call lights. No waiting for your shift to pass. Just real nursing, strong teamwork, and the chance to make a meaningful impact.

Job Description

As an LPN with Southern Health Partners, you will:

Deliver direct patient care and medication administration

Conduct nursing assessments and intake screenings

Assist with emergency response and triage situations

Monitor chronic care patients and treatment plans

Maintain accurate documentation and medical records

Collaborate closely with RNs, providers, and correctional staff

Help create a safe, professional, and compassionate care environment

This position offers the opportunity to sharpen your clinical judgment while working in a unique healthcare setting where autonomy and teamwork go hand in hand.
